Southwick Regional has gone 7-0 against Hampden Charter School of Science recently and they'll look to pad the win column further on Tuesday. The Southwick Regional Rams will take on Hampden Charter School of Science at 5:15 p.m. Southwick Regional is coming into the game on a four-game losing streak.
Last Friday, Southwick Regional came up short against Smith Vo-Tech and fell 3-1.
While Southwick Regional ultimately came up short, they didn't go down without a fight: they scored at least 18 points in every set they played. The match finished with set scores of 25-20, 25-23, 22-25, 25-18.
Southwick Regional might have lost, but man, Melanie Kantianis was a machine: she had 19 digs and five aces. That's the most aces Kantianis has posted in her last eight contests.
Even though they lost, Southwick Regional was lethal from the service line and finished the game with 13 aces.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now served at least seven aces in eight consecutive matches.
Meanwhile, Hampden Charter School of Science was able to grind out a solid victory over John J. Duggan Academy on Friday, taking the game 3-1. The win made it back-to-back victories for Hampden Charter School of Science.
Southwick Regional's loss dropped their record down to 5-11. As for Hampden Charter School of Science, their win ended a three-game drought at home and bumped them up to 4-9.
Southwick Regional beat Hampden Charter School of Science 3-1 in their previous meeting back in September. The rematch might be a little tougher for Southwick Regional since the squad won't have the home-court adv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
